I'm hoping to buy a second hand G5 soon and have read up on the chirping issue. I hear the issue effects all G5 revisions, I'm wondering if it effects some revisions more than others.

Also - would it effect single processor G5's?



Finally, is the 5200 Nvidia card substantially better than the FX 5200 Go ? and would I be able to play games such as Colin Mcrae Rally at 1280x1024 (on low settings)?

Something to watch out for is the liquid cooling system used on the 2.5Ghz and faster GS setup. If the system develops a leak, ita all over in seconds. Literally. If you want to buy a G5 Powermac, get the 2.3 Ghz or below since they don't use the liquid system.

Of coarse, a G5 + faulty liquid cooling + Applecare could = a new MP.
